MABEL A. BUCHECKER departed this life on Saturday, December 3, 2016, surrounded by loved ones. Mabel was born in the hills of the Ozarks on October 5, 1933 to parents Harrison and Ella West.

Adventurous, resourceful, and headstrong, Mabel knew from an early age that there was a great big world out there waiting for her. At age 14 she ventured alone to St. Louis where she worked at a title company to support herself and send money home to help her parents. At 19 she married Winston Daggett and together they had one child, Terri. After the dissolution of her marriage of 7 years, on a trip through New Mexico, she met and married the love of her life William A. Buchecker, and they celebrated nearly 50 years of marriage up until his death in 2011. Together they had one child, Michelle. Mabel was always proud that she was a country girl who went from a one room schoolhouse with an 8th grade education to a college graduate. She was an avid reader and loved to travel, her last trip at age 80 aboard a cruise to Alaska. Mabel loved to entertain and spent many years volunteering her time to help others. She was a devoted wife, mother, and homemaker and in her later years was best known for her baking skills and surprise visits to friends, neighbors, hospital workers, and strangers with arms full of yummy treats. Anyone who had a chance to sit and talk with Mabel always left with a smile on their face and feeling better about themselves.
